Description

MISSION

Develop and improve production processes in terms of productivity, quality and reduction of associated costs on an ongoing basis through optimal design respecting applicable standards.


GENERAL FUNCTIONS
Establish the specifications and technological requirements to be developed for new processes.

Ensure implementation of Ficosa process standards.


Collaborate on analyzing production problems (productivity and quality) for the plant, proposing appropriate corrective measures to improve the process through global standards.

Participate in the Projects meetings.


Take part in quote process for new projects, analyzing the product's design to guarantee optimal industrialization, and analyze the costs and investments associated with the industrialization.

Take part in R&D projects for new products, contributing to the necessary solutions from a processes standpoint.

Take part in the benchmarking teams, helping analyze matters related to the processes.

Research and develop new technology for production processes, with the aim of improving the existing ones.

Propose improvements to current process standards.

Support continuous improvement activities in the production processes at the plant of responsibility.

Observe Ficosa's Code of Ethics to avoid fraudulent practices. Comply with Information Security Management System (ISMS) applicable to the job, along with the training related thereto.

Actively cooperate in maintaining, promoting and improving the OHSE and Quality department.

POSITION REQUIREMENTS

Academic background:

Bachelor's degree in electronic, mechanic, automotion or similar engineering


Languages:

Fluent in local language & Fluent in English (writing, speaking & reading)


Experience:

Minimum of 3 years as a plant processes engineer in automotive industry

Minimum of 5 years in other similar position


Travel:

Willing to travel


OTHER SPECIFICATIONS

Additional training:

Automation systems programming and design (PLC, HMI, robots, servo-drives, vision systems, etc.); mechanical engineering; specific knowledge of processes in area of responsibility; lean manufacturing methods, Six Sigma problem solving, analysis and statistics tools; ISO TS requirements
